Leonard Bernstein’s legendary live recording of Beethoven’s Ode To Freedom ...No. 22297 Leonard Bernstein In his early years (1921-1926, from 3 years old to 8 or 9) Leonard Bernstein, the composer and conductor, lived in Dorchester. The family then moved to nearby Roxbury, where they lived until 1934 (Leonard was approximately 10 years old to about 16) , when they moved to Newton, MA.

Leonard Bernstein (1918-1990) was a prominent composer and conductor for live performance whose last residence was the Dakota, moving there with his family in 1975. Two of his former residences included the Studio Towers atop Carnegie Hall and the Osborne Apartments .

Leonard Bernstein arrived in Munich, Germany, in May 1948 as a 29-year-old American conductor, still practically unknown in Europe. Lenny was devastated to discover a city still so utterly “shell-shocked,” three years (almost to the day) after Germany’s surrender. Known for his deep, resonant voice and profound lyrics, C...Bernstein's first TV appearances were actually for adults. In the early 1950's, he created segments about classical music for the groundbreaking "Omnibus" series, hosted by Alistair Cooke. But by 1957 Bernstein had convinced CBS to put his Young People's Concerts on the air.
